About the role
Responsibilities
- Drive exceptional customer service by guiding the team to deliver personalized styling advice and expert product knowledge
- Interpret sales data to drive performance and take full ownership of the store’s commercial success
- Lead and inspire a team of managers, visual merchandisers, and sales advisors to exceed service and operational standards
- Manage recruitment, onboarding, and training processes for all new team members
- Identify high-potential individuals and create tailored development plans to support career growth
- Oversee all aspects of store operations, including compliance and visual merchandising, to ensure efficiency and excellence
- Foster a positive, inclusive, and motivating work environment
Requirements
- Proven retail experience with a strong customer-centric mindset
- Strong commercial awareness and understanding of retail KPIs
- Demonstrated ability to lead teams in fast-paced retail environments
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to engage customers and teams effectively
- Experience in coaching, providing constructive feedback, and supporting staff development
- Strong understanding of store operations, compliance, and security standards
- Ability to work a flexible schedule, including evenings, weekends, and holidays
Benefits
- 25% employee discount across all H&M Group brands (online and in-store)
- H&M Incentive Program (HIP) to reward contributions
- Annual health check-up and wellness contribution
- Special leave and financial support for family events
- 15 days annual leave and 5 days sick leave
- Internal career development opportunities and training programs
- Store incentive scheme
